## Support

ChipRelay reads timing chips at the mat and pushes splits to the Finishline feed. If a reader drops offline mid-race, it buffers locally for up to four hours, so don't panic — just don't cut a release while a race is live. Check the reader health page before tagging. Got a weird reading or release question? Drop a note here.

escalation mailbox, bafog-fafog: ulador@paliqlabs.internal

All inbound links pass through a single validation gate before routing. Scheme and host are checked against a signed allowlist fetched at startup; unverifiable links fall back to the web view, never to native screens. Parameters are strictly typed and length-capped; anything else is dropped, not sanitized. Intent forwarding to third-party apps is disabled except for the payments handoff, which requires a fresh attestation token. Allowlist refresh cadence and token lifetimes are set by the constants below.

tuning table, kajog-bawip:
TIERS = {
    "kelius": 256,
    "lammir": 543,
}

Step 4: Configure the circuit breaker for calls to the Quillport upstream API. Your plugin must not implement its own retry loop; the breaker in the Tansy SDK handles half-open probes automatically. Set BREAKER_THRESHOLD to 5 failures and BREAKER_COOLDOWN to 60 seconds unless your plugin is latency-sensitive, in which case consult the tuning appendix. These values live in your plugin's env file alongside the upstream credentials. The API credential that the breaker uses for its health probes is set on the line immediately after this step.

vault entry, kahip-fahog: RELAY_SECRET20=6a2c791de808f35c3b55